Geographic Range & Migration

Stripe-tailed Hummingbird

Found in humid forests from Mexico to Panama at 500-2,000 m elevation. Resident in Central American highlands.

Great Sapphirewing

Found in high Andean cloud forests and páramo from Colombia south through Ecuador and Peru to Bolivia. 2,400–3,800 m.

Great Sapphirewing

A large hummingbird (18 cm, wingspan 28 cm) found in Andean cloud forests from Colombia to Bolivia at 2,500-3,500 m. Brilliant sapphire-blue wings, green body, and long tail. One of the largest hummingbirds. Nectarivore of montane forest, visiting large-flowered Ericaceae.
